In The Letter to the Romans, noted Scottish Bible interpreter William Barclay follows the formula of The Daily Study Bible by first giving the text for the day's study in his own translation, followed by two or three pages of commentary.

If you want to know the story behind the passage, William Barclay is your man. His books are all rich in helping you understand the whys and when of the books of the New Testament. His commentary of Romans is no exception. It helps you understand why the book was written, to who it was written. No one provides better insight. Because of his critical approach, he does sometime question authenticity and leave the reader wondering if the passage truly is inspired or simply a historical recoded of fact or tradition of man.
